Mate Selection
This process involves choosing a partner for romantic or sexual relationships, based on various factors such as personal preferences, social norms, and evolutionary influences.
Mate Guarding
Behavioral strategies implemented by individuals to prevent their mates from engaging in mating opportunities with rivals.
Halo Effect
A cognitive bias where an individual's overall impression of a person influences their feelings and thoughts about that person's character or properties.
Positive Traits
Inherent characteristics or qualities of an individual that are perceived as beneficial, admirable, or conducive to success and well-being.
